A bag contains (2n+1) coins. It is known that n of these coins have a head on both sides, whereas the remaining (n+1) coins are fair. A coin is picked up at random from the bag and tossed. If the probability that the toss results in a head is 31/42, then n is equal to
A
10
B
11
C
12
D
13
Answer
10
Explanation
Solution
Total number of coins =2n+1
Consider the following events:
E1= Getting a coin having head on both sides from the bag.
E2= Getting a fair coin from the bag
A= Toss results in a head
Given: P(A)=4231,P(E1)=2n+1n
and P(E2)=2n+1n+1
Then, P(A)=P(E1)P(AE1)+P(E2)P(A/E2)
⇒4231=2n+1n×1+2n+1n+1×21
4231=2n+1n+2(2n+1)n+1
⇒4231=2(2n+1)3n+1
⇒2131=2n+13n+1
n=10
